R.I.P. Dick Gautier, Hymie From Get Smart 1931-2016

by Paul Cashmere on January 17, 2017

in News

Dick Gautier, best known as Hymie the robot in the 60s TV series Get Smart, has died at age 85.

In 1960, Gautier played Conrad Birdie in the original Broadway production of Bye Bye Birdie. In 1967 he played opposite Dick van Dyke in the movie Divorce American Style.

Over the years Gautier had parts in The Patty Duke Show, Gidget and Bewitched but it was the role of Hymie in Get Smart that made him world famous.

In the Get Smart plot Hymie the humanoid robot was built by KAOS but turned “nice” by Maxwell Smart for CONTROL.

Hymie’s first appearance in Get Smart was in Episode 19, Back To The Old Drawing Board.

Gautier died at an assisted living facility in Arcadia, California. He is survived by his former wife Tess; daughter’s Denise and Chris and son Rand; grandchildren Darby, Brandon, Megan and Elisa; and great-grandchildren Reya, Bella, Odette, Jade and Avery.
